Powder days are a few of the most fun days on the snow, but powder riding requires certain methods and strategies. Listed here are a few quick processes for snowboarding in powder.

1) Except if you're aiming to create a tight turn, only use light pressure when submiting powder. Turning way too hard can make exorbitant edge angle, which essentially means your snowboard will burrow to the snow and you will end up below 30 cm of powder, instead of on the top.

Aim to utilize a light touch when turning.

2) One common error made when submiting powder would be to lean over your snowboard's nose, together with your torso to force a turn. Do not try out this. This tends to dig your snowboard's nose to the powder and end up getting you flying through the air.

You wish to always try to keep the body weight between your snowboard or perhaps a bit towards the rear of one's snowboard. Take advantage of your hips, knees and ankles to complete the majority of the turning. Deep powder is comparable to surfing on water, you ought to be riding within the snow while continuing to help keep your nose from tunneling in.

3) Speed will undoubtedly be your friend. Powder will decelerate your snowboard, so attempt to keep your accelerate. Speed will help you cut the right path through the powder, along with helping stop you getting bogged down on flat runs.

Advice for gladed ski runs:

Riding deep powder in gladed runs is extremely difficult. It's considered among the hardest skills to understand, so you shouldn't be disheartened if you get getting swamped. Here are a few strategies for riding in gladed runs.

1) All of your human body follows anywhere your face looks. What this means is if you look at trees, you'll wind up snowboarding directly into a tree. Because of this, you will need to often be taking a look at the gaps between your trees.

2) You shouldn't go fast in a gladed run, before you know the region. Always conduct a slower run to get at know the region first. Tree runs are extremely fast and demand that you realize the region, so set aside a second to explore the run first.

3) The key reason why gladed runs are incredibly difficult, is basically because you're combining sharp, rapid turns in powder, by having an obstacle course. Whenever you're within the gladed run, start to plan a few turns in front of where you stand. The tighter the trees, the more you need to be certain you realize the very best places to show, in order to avoid running directly into a tree.

4) Gladed runs in many cases are full of 'tree wells', which are deep chambers of snow at the bottom of a tree. They're absolutely dangerous in the event you get stuck within them, especially if further snow drops from the tree branches and covers that person.
